High Altitude Trailer Xt50 recalled over injury risk
- Recall date
- July 28, 2020
- Source
- National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A)
- Official notice title
- High Altitude Trailer Co LLC recalls 2019–2020 High Altitude Trailer Xt50
- Recall number
- 20V432000
- Brand / firm
- High Altitude Trailer
- Sold / distributed
- Potentially affected: 6 units
Why it was recalled
If the rear swing arm spare tire carrier bracket weld fails, the spare tire may separate from the vehicle, increasing the risk of a crash.
What was recalled
High Altitude Trailer Co, LLC (HATC) is recalling certain 2019-2020 XT50 trailers retrofitted with a black rear swing arm spare tire carrier. The weld on the retrofitted rear swing arm bracket may fail causing the rear swing arm, spare tire, and any other attached items to break away from the trailer frame.
What to do
HATC has notified owners, and dealers will add reinforcing welds along the top seam of the swing arm bracket and trailer frame, free of charge. For customers not in the immediate region, the manufacturer will coordinate with a local welding repair shop to add the welds and reimburse the shop directly. The recall began July 28, 2020. Owners may contact HATC customer service at 1-720-391-6685. HATC's number for this recall is 2020G27.. Follow the official notice for full instructions.
